Product Description
Keep an eye on your home, place of business, cars, and valuables. Watch your pets and your kids. Monitor your nanny, babysitter, or employees. Blue Iris is professional-grade software incorporating the latest video software technologies, including MPEG and Windows Media webcasting. Use up to 25 cameras (webcams, camcorders, network IP cams or analog cards). Use motion detection, audio detection, or capture continuously. Overlay text and graphics. Use the built-in web server, or post to a website. Receive alerts via loudspeaker, e-mail, instant messaging, or phone.

Editor's Review
Blue Iris - Things We Like
It can connect to and display visual feeds from multiple cameras, up to 64 at a time, which can be of different types including web cams, digital cameras and camcorders, network cameras and mobile phones. It can take screenshots as well as capture movies in a wide variety of formats. The feeds can be bundled and transmitted by Blue Iris Download to a website easily with a simple interface. It includes support for the remote control and even automated triggering of cameras based on motion. It can then send you an alert in a variety of formats.
Blue Iris - Things We Didn't Like
The processing demands of these tasks are very high and will require a beefy PC to run, this is perhaps inevitable for this sort of task but you will need to run a powerful PC at 100% to use feeds from even a small number of cameras. A limitation that needs a Blue Iris review is that the program will only run on Windows operating systems, no support exists for Linux.
